Description

Dolibarr 9.0.0 through 23.0.4 saves inbound email attachments under the name supplied in the message's MIME headers without reducing it to a safe basename. The global saveAttachment() in htdocs/emailcollector/lib/emailcollector.lib.php builds $filepath = $path . $filename . '.' . $ext and hands it to file_put_contents(), and the private saveAttachment() in htdocs/emailcollector/class/emailcollector.class.php writes to $destdir.'/'.$filename; the name reaches both from the attachment's own getName() or getFilename() value by way of the record-join, create-ticket and create-project operations. A traversal sequence in the filename therefore survives intact, so any sender who can email a mailbox that an EmailCollector monitors, which is the module's ordinary use for a support or ticket inbox, can place attacker-controlled content outside the per-object attachment directory without holding a Dolibarr account. Under the hardened layout Dolibarr's SECURITY.md requires, with htdocs read-only, the write is confined to the documents tree and corrupts or forges other objects' documents; where htdocs is writable the same primitive reaches a web-executable path. Version 24.0.0 applies dol_sanitizePathName() and dol_sanitizeFileName() before the write.
